01 — Overview

Oral care, treated as hardware.

Korra is a conceptual oral-care system that moves away from the softness of wellness packaging and the sterility of clinical dental brands. Built around brushed steel, precise typography, modular product logic, and technical-reference graphics, the identity reframes a daily object as something more durable, tactile, and performance-led.

02 — APPROACH

Specified, not styled.

Industrial product language.
The system references the visual codes of engineered objects: brushed metal finishes, component diagrams, material notes, refill logic, and clear product hierarchy.

Machined visual identity.
A tight wordmark, engraved-style motif, and compact typographic system give the brand a harder, more technical register across product, packaging, and digital touchpoints.

Owner’s manual clarity.
Packaging, refill documentation, instruction cards, and ecommerce details are treated as part of the brand system. The tone is direct, material, and functional rather than lifestyle-driven.

03 — IN PRACTICE

A daily object with
technical presence.

Korra tests how an oral-care brand can feel precise, durable, and design-led without relying on pastel wellness cues or generic clinical language. The system extends across identity, product direction, packaging, technical graphics, refill materials, and digital commerce.
